BOOK REVIEW: THE GOOD, THE BAD AND THE UNDECIDED by LAURIE BELL

The Blurb:

Everyone – the good, the bad and the undecided – has a story.

While Toni Delle is crisscrossing the sector, investigating a criminal empire intent on war, other members of the White Fire world are busy with their own endeavours. The businessman closing a treasonous deal that will bring conflict to the galaxy. The politician giving the biggest speech of her career in the shadow of an assassin. The smuggler who can’t be trusted, desperate for redemption. The Good, the Bad and the Undecided is a collection of twelve short stories set during the thrilling events of White Fire – A Toni Delle Adventure. A cast of guns-for-hire, undercover agents, revolutionaries and rogues reveal their part in Toni’s adventures. Because everyone – the good, the bad and the undecided – has a story.

The Review:

‘The Good, the Bad and The Undecided’ is a great addition to Laurie Bell’s novel ‘White Fire.’ It consists of a collection of short stories and scenes involving characters and events covered in the original book, expanding and adding detail to the background of ‘White Fire’ and the collection of heroes, villains and others, some of whom we have met before. Rather than being standalone stories, each short narrative interweaves cleverly with the others. It’s a great idea, although I would highly recommend reading ‘White Fire’ first to get the most out of this anthology. The writing is excellent, and Bell has a clear vision of the world she has created and the different lives within it. And on top of that, it’s really good fun, with loads of humour and action along the way. A definite must for lovers of sci-fi. I hope there will be more from this series in the future.

Summary: A great idea, really well executed, that expands on the original book and adds new layers and whole lot of fun.
